Update by user Mar 12, 2013
WF would not refund money but offered to deliver another plant.Received the plant - again left on porch in the winter time.
Althought it was frozen solid I tried again to nurse this TINY little $79 plant to health as it was supposed to bring me good luck. Well within a few days it was dead from the cold! Wound up throwing it in the trash and I will broadcast to everyone i know that this company is horrible. After reading the other reviews on this site, it appears that I'm one of the lucky ones.
At least mine weren't for a funeral or romantic reason!!I will never use them.
Original review posted by user Feb 09, 2013
Plant took almost two weeks to deliver.Delivered and left outside on a 10-degree day.
Picture on website showed a beautiful bamboo plant in a bamboo container. Arrived as two bare stalks in a tacky shiny red container. It was sent to me as a good luck plant from a friend because I opened a new business. Now she's afraid it will scare new customers away.
Besides the fact that it was frozen solid it is definitely a "charlie brown" bamboo plant. No directions were enclosed for the care/planting and when I called the number on the card i was told "I wouldn't know... I'm not a florist".
WOW!$79 for this - money definitely not well spent.
